General Description
Supervises, plans and directs land surveying activities.

- Assists with supervising and evaluating staff; provides input in hiring, termination and disciplinary action decisions.
- Assists with all aspects of survey projects requested by county departments.
- Provides necessary support to the county's legal department.
- Participates in the development and implementation of policies and procedures, rules and regulations in accordance with County, State and Federal requirements.
- Reviews plans and plats for compliance with applicable regulations.
- Confers with developers, engineers and surveyors.
- Investigates complaints; answers technical questions concerning ordinances or other regulations and related matters.
- Advises County Engineer on the status of various surveying and engineering projects.
- Sets up and operates surveying and GPS equipment; downloads and processes GPS data.
- Prepares written reports; maintains files and records.
- Interacts with the public in an effective and courteous manner.

REQUIRED K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ES :
Knowledge of land surveying in Florida; principles and practices of land and civil engineering survey systems; modern surveying equipment, practices and techniques.
Required to operate a personal computer; set up and operate modern survey instruments and tools.
Required to read, understand and interpret diagrams, construction plans, specifications, Florida Statutes, codes and related documents; express ideas effectively both orally and in writing; establish and maintain working relationship with employees, contractors, engineers and public.
Minimum & Preferred Qualifications
Bachelor's Degree from an accredited four year college or university in Surveying, Civil Engineering or closely related field; supplemented by three (3) years of surveying experience; one (1) year of which shall be in a lead / supervisory capacity; or an equivalent combination of education, training and experience that provides the required knowledge, skills and abilities.
LICENSURE AND / OR CERTIFICATIONS :
Requires a valid driver license at the date of hire and maintain said license while employed in this position. Requires a Florida Professional Surveyor and Mapper license within six (6) months of employment and maintain said license while employed in this position.
